About this property

A FANTASTIC FAMILY HOME situated in the North East of Ipswich close to Northgate High School. With only a twenty five minute walk into the town centre, and situated on the (route 66) bus route. BEING OFFERED CHAIN FREE.

With period features, Three bedrooms, a good sized sitting/dining room, fitted kitchen, utility room, D/S bathroom, and a south facing un-overlooked rear garden. This property is not to be missed!

Entrance Hall

A decorative storm porch leads to a heavy timber and glazed external front door, exposed timber flooring, decorative coving, ornate attractive architrave, stairs leading to first floor, door off to living/dining room, with kitchen, utility room and bathroom to the rear.

Sitting/dining room

With bay window to front aspect, window to rear aspect, smooth plastered ceiling with coving, a victorian style gas real flame coal effect fireplace, exposed timber floorboards, two radiators. Under stair storage cupboard and door leading onto kitchen.

Kitchen

Window and external door to side aspect and door leading onto utility room. A range of matching eye level and base level work units with work surfaces over and stainless steel sink and drainer unit with mixer tap over and tiled splashbacks, space for free standing fridge space and plumbing for dishwasher and space for under counter fridge, integral gas hob with extractor hood over, integral gas oven. fitted spotlights, ceramic floor tiles.

Utility Room

Window to side aspect and internal door to bathroom, a range of matching base level work units with laminate work surface over, smooth plastered ceiling, radiator, ceramic floor tiles.

Family Bathroom

Obscure glazed window to side aspect, panel bath, a pedestal style wash hand basin, low level water closet, radiator, ceramic floor tiles.

Landing

Doors off to bedrooms one, two, three, further pine door with ladder leading to attic.

Bedroom One

With two windows to front aspect, radiator.

Bedroom Two

Window to rear aspect, radiator.

Bedroom Three

Window to rear aspect overlooking the rear garden, a built in cupboard housing hot water tank, radiator.

Front Garden

Brick walled to the front and side boundary,mainly laid to slabs with slate chippings for ease of maintenance, path leads to the storm porch.

Rear Garden

Predominantly laid to lawn, with hard standing patio area, enclosed with timber fencing, external tap, paved discrete bin store, Beside the house a timber gate provides access to the shared gate and the front of the property.

The county town of Ipswich is served by a wide range of local amenities including schools, University, shops, doctors, dental surgeries, hospital, two theatres, parks, recreational facilities and mainline railway station providing direct links to London Liverpool Station. The town has also undergone an extensive rebuilding and a gentrification programme principally around the vibrant waterfront which now boasts some lovely bars and restaurants.

This property is offered through Modern Method of Auction. Should you view, offer or bid your data will be shared with the Auctioneer, iamsold Limited. This method requires both parties to complete the transaction within 56 days, allowing buyers to proceed with mortgage finance (subject to lending criteria, affordability and survey). The buyer is required to sign a reservation agreement and make payment of a non-refundable Reservation Fee of 4.5% of the purchase price including VAT, subject to a minimum of £6,600.00 including VAT. This fee is paid in addition to purchase price and will be considered as part of the chargeable consideration for the property in the calculation for stamp duty liability. Buyers will be required to complete an identification process with iamsold and provide proof of how the purchase would be funded.

The property has a Buyer Information Pack containing documents about the property. The documents may not tell you everything you need to know, so you must complete your own due diligence before bidding. A sample of the Reservation Agreement and terms and conditions are contained within this pack. The buyer will also make payment of £349 inc. VAT towards the preparation cost of the pack.
